PKD - why kidney doctors don’t treat it unless it’s malignant? Is there something that can help prevent the progression.

Kidney doctors often adopt a watchful waiting approach to PKD, or Polycystic Kidney Disease, mainly because current medical options are limited in addressing the underlying cause of the cyst formation directly. The reluctance to intervene aggressively unless there’s malignancy or serious complications lies in balancing benefits against risks—many interventions can have unintended consequence, so it’s often better to observe unless absolutely necessary.

In terms of prevention and slowing progression, Ayurveda presents a perspective focused on balancing energies, or doshas—especially Kapha and Vata, thought to be central in maintaining kidney health. Here are soem personalized suggestions you might consider:

1. Dietary Adjustment — A Kapha-pacifying diet plays an essential role. Incorporate warming spices such as ginger, turmeric, and black pepper into meals. Reduce sodium intake to alleviate kidney load, while focusing on lighter, easily-digestible food. Stay clear of red meat and reduce alcohol.

2. Herbal Support — The incorporation of herbs like Punarnava (Boerhavia diffusa) and Gokshura (Tribulus terrestris) can support kidney function gently. These can be taken as formulations or under direct supervision of an Ayurvedic practitioner. They can help manage the body’s fluid balance and relieve stress on the kidneys.

3. Lifestyle Practices — Incorporate regular exercise like brisk walks or yoga, emphasizing postures that gently massage the kidney area, aiding circulation and energy flow. These should be gentle and attuned to your capacity to avoid excess stress.

4. Hydration — Maintain adequate hydration, although avoid overloading the kidneys with excessive fluids. Listen to your thirst cues and aim for a balance that doesn’t strain your system.

Lastly, while Ayurveda provides supportive care and preventive strategies, regular monitoring by a healthcare professional is vital in managing potential complications. If symptoms such as severe pain, blood in urine, or high blood pressure arise, these require prompt attention from your healthcare provider. Balancing traditional practices with necessary medical oversight is critical to maintaining a harmonious approach to health.

Polycystic Kidney Disease (PKD) often progresses slowly, with no immediate symptoms requiring intervention unless complications occur, such as high blood pressure, infections, or kidney failure. Conventional medicine typically focuses on managing these complications rather than directly treating PKD itself unless severe kidney damage or a malignant transformation occurs.

In the Siddha-Ayurvedic approach, preventing PKD’s progression involves balancing the doshas and supporting kidney function. Consider adopting dietary modifications that support a tridoshic balance, but especially pacify Kapha and Pitta doshas. Avoid overly salty foods, dairy, and processed sugars, as they may exacerbate cyst development.

Herbal treatments like Punarnava (Boerhavia diffusa) and Varuna (Crataeva nurvala) may support kidney health. Punarnava helps reduce fluid retention and might improve kidney function, while Varuna is traditionally used for urinary tract support. Including these in your daily routine, after consulting a practitioner, could be beneficial.

Maintaining strong agni, or digestive fire, is crucial too—use spices like ginger and turmeric to enhance digestion. Regular practice of pranayama (breathing exercises) can aid detoxification and balance energy channels like nadis.

However, it’s important to stay in touch with your healthcare provider for monitoring. If your condition involves acute symptoms or major changes, consider seeking immediate medical attention. Combining modern medical oversight with Siddha-Ayurvedic practices can provide a holistic approach to managing PKD.
